Founded in 1978 by the Galadari Brothers, Khaleej Times is the first English-language daily newspaper in the UAE. Over the decades it has grown into one of the most respected news platforms in the Gulf, known for reliable reporting on business, politics, lifestyle, sports, and culture, with a strong digital presence locally and internationally.
